Client & Objective

BakerBaird Communications, on behalf of Bramcote Bereavement Services, approached me to create an explainer video promoting their new prepaid cremation plans at Bramcote Crematorium. This animation was part of a broader campaign that included posters, brochures, and social media content.

The goal was to create a sensitive, engaging, and approachable animation that would help their audience understand the benefits of prepaid cremation plans.

The Challenge

Creating an animation around such a delicate topic was a challenge in itself.

The key considerations were:

  • Ensuring the animation remained warm, human, and approachable.

  • Choosing a character style that resonated with the audience while fitting the message.

  • Working within a limited budget while maintaining high-quality production values.

The most significant creative challenge was designing the characters. They needed to be visually appealing, easy to animate, and capable of conveying subtle emotions that fit the overall tone of the animation.

The Solution

To achieve a warm and inviting feel, I chose a color palette with soft, warm tones and animated with smooth, slow-motion movements. The animation also featured subtle, airy transitions, all complemented by a calm and reassuring music. These elements worked together to create a gentle, comforting experience for the audience.

For character animation, I used Duik and Joysticks & Sliders in After Effects. These tools allowed me to:

  • Automate rigging, saving time and ensuring smooth movements.

  • Create separate body parts for animation, allowing fluid motion without breaking the design.

  • Animate head movements subtly, preventing the characters from looking static.

I carefully designed and rigged the characters so that their limbs and body moved naturally. The animation also maintained continuous motion, ensuring there was always something happening on screen to keep the visuals engaging.

Key Takeaways and Lessons Learned

This project was a great learning experience, particularly in the areas of:

  • Character design and animation – I refined my workflow for designing and rigging characters in a way that allows natural movement.

  • Project workflow and time management – Managing a project with a sensitive subject and ensuring clear communication with the agency and client.

  • Creative decision-making – Developing a warm, approachable animation style for a challenging topic.

Every project presents a learning opportunity, and this one reinforced the idea that even the most challenging topics can be turned into engaging visual stories with the right creative approach.
